
The CBI on Tuesday raided the house of Karti, son of former Union Minister P Chidambaram. These raids have been done at his residence in Sivagangai and Chennai, apart from Delhi and Mumbai. This raid by CBI has been done in a money laundering case. Please tell me that many cases are going on against Chidambaram's son. These include the case of INX Media getting FIPB (Foreign Investment Promotion Board) clearance, which is related to about 305 crore foreign funds. This is the case when Chidambaram was the Finance Minister. Because of these, this raid has been done.
Sources say that the investigating agency has registered a new case against Karti which is related to money received from abroad. This money was received during the year 2010-14.
